HEALTH STATES UTILITY VALUES IN OSTEOPOROSIS USING TIME TRADE-OFF

OBJECTIVES: To investigate health state utility values in osteoporosis and osteoporotic fractures using time trade-off method. METHODS: We developed survey questionnaires of time trade-off method for 8 health states; osteoporosis and 7 osteoporotic fractures including hip, spine, post-hip(1 year after hip fracture), post-spine(1 year after spine fracture), upper arm, wrist, and ankle. 500 females aged 49-59 were interviewed for the survey from 15 October to 30 November, 2016. Utility values for each health state were calculated and compared to the EQ-5D scores based on Korean National Health and Nutrition & Examination Survey. RESULTS: The utility values for each health state differed. Hip fracture and vertebral fractures demonstrated the lowest scores (0.3) followed by post-hip and post-spine fractures (0.45). The highest was 0.67 for osteoporosis. Given that the utility of osteoporosis based on EQ-5D index scores from Korean National Health and Nutrition Examination Survey (KHNANES) was 0.84, health utility using time trade-off method showed a lower value (0.67). CONCLUSIONS: Using time trade-off scenarios for eight health states related to osteoporosis, we examined health utilities for each state. Generally, the trend of scores was proportional to the severity of health states.
